On 9 November, 2024, members of the Runner Force from S.H. Ho College, CUHK participated in the “Yangshuo 100 international Hiking & Trail Running Race” in Guilin city, Guangxi.

The runners from S.H. Ho College, CUHK arrived a day early to collect their participant packs. On the day of the race, the marathon team from Harmonia College, CUHK(SZ) also joined the competition. Throughout the race, members from both colleges supported each other, ran together and ultimately achieved outstanding results. The event allowed them to relax and fostered a great sense of unity and friendship.
